Lee's timeless classic unfolds in the racially charged landscape of the American South. Through the eyes of Scout Finch, the novel addresses themes of morality, compassion, and the fight against injustice. With Atticus Finch as a beacon of righteousness, "To Kill a Mockingbird" weaves a narrative that resonates with its powerful portrayal of societal and individual challenges.
